Experimental and modeling analysis on the optimization of combined VVT and EGR strategies in turbocharged direct-injection gasoline engines with VNT

Jose Galindo et al.

Summary: The research focused on analyzing a gasoline engine complying with EURO 6 standards in order to optimize combined VVT and EGR strategies for reducing fuel consumption. Through a combination of 1D engine simulations and limited experimental work, the most efficient configuration of VVT and EGR systems was determined. Additionally, a thorough evaluation of pressure traces and mass flows in intake and exhaust valves provided insights for the optimization process.

PROCEEDINGS OF THE INSTITUTION OF MECHANICAL ENGINEERS PART D-JOURNAL OF AUTOMOBILE ENGINEERING (2021)
